Understanding Quality Consistency in Clear Plastic Protective Film Manufacturing

Quality consistency is a critical factor for businesses when selecting suppliers for clear plastic protective films. Manufacturers of these films often utilize various materials and production processes, which can lead to significant differences in the final product. As a result, some companies may find that their chosen manufacturer consistently delivers high-quality films, while others may experience variability in performance and durability.

One of the main challenges in ensuring consistent quality is the reliance on raw materials. Variations in the quality of plastic resins or additives can directly impact the properties of the protective film, such as clarity, adhesion, and resistance to environmental factors. Manufacturers that prioritize sourcing high-quality materials tend to produce more reliable products over time.

Additionally, the manufacturing process itself plays a crucial role in quality consistency. Companies that invest in advanced technology and maintain stringent quality control measures are more likely to achieve uniform results. Regular testing and monitoring during production can help identify any deviations early on, allowing manufacturers to address issues before they affect the final product.

Factors Influencing Quality Control

Several factors influence the quality control processes employed by clear plastic protective film manufacturers. One major aspect is the level of automation in their production lines. Automated systems can reduce human error and improve precision, leading to a more consistent output. In contrast, facilities that rely heavily on manual labor may face greater variability in product quality due to inconsistencies in operator skills and techniques.

Moreover, the company culture surrounding quality assurance can significantly affect consistency. Manufacturers that emphasize quality as a core value are more likely to develop rigorous protocols for testing and quality checks. This commitment to excellence often translates into better overall performance and customer satisfaction.

Finally, the scale of production can also impact quality consistency. Smaller manufacturers may offer more personalized service and flexibility, but they might struggle to maintain the same level of quality as larger operations that can afford to invest in comprehensive quality control systems. Balancing the benefits of scale with attention to detail is essential for achieving consistent quality.
